On Mon, 12 Mar 2012, Tom Weber wrote:
After looking at the API, I think I have found a solution.
libssh2_channel_window_read_ex() can check if there is data waiting on a
channel, without reading from the socket.
Using that API you can know how much data that is already read off the socket
and is waiting for you to get read, yes.
So we would have to run a libssh2_channel_window_read_ex() loop after each
libssh2_channel_read_ex() loop, and repeat both loops until
libssh2_channel_window_read_ex() returns zero for all channels.
I would do it simpler. I would just do this:
select() on socket
if(readable) {
for(loop over all channels) {
rc = libssh2_channel_read_ex( channel [check index] ...);
...
}
}
